Karl Lewis Anderson 1875–1920 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 1875

Birth Location: Wisconsin, USA

Death Date: BEF 1920

Death Location: Osage, Mitchell, Iowa, USA

Father:

Mother:

Spouse(s): Thonetta Brenden

Children(s): Myrtle Anderson, Rudolph Anderson

The story of Karl Lewis Anderson began in 1875 in Wisconsin, USA. Karl Lewis Anderson married Thonetta Nettie Halvorsdatter Brenden, and had children including Myrtle Ruth Anderson, Rudolph A Anderson. Karl Lewis Anderson passed away in 1920 in Osage, Mitchell, Iowa, USA.
